The Treatment Steps



After your initial examination, you'll go on to the actual treatment actions for your full-arch substitute. The initial step entails management of anesthesia, ensuring you're comfortable and pain-free throughout the procedure.

Once you're unwinded, your dental expert will begin by getting rid of any type of staying teeth in the arc. This step might spend some time, yet it's critical for the success of your new oral implants.

Next off, your dental expert will certainly prepare your jawbone for the implants. This might entail bone implanting if your bone density isn't sufficient.

When your jawbone prepares, they'll strategically put the oral implants right into the bone. This is typically done in a certain order to ensure stability.



After the implants are positioned, your dentist will certainly attach a short-term prosthesis to help you preserve function and look while the implants incorporate with the bone. This healing phase usually lasts numerous months, enabling your jawbone to fuse with the implants securely.

Ultimately, once recovery is complete, you'll return for the placement of your permanent prosthesis. At this stage, your new arc will certainly be changed for comfort and aesthetic appeals, offering you a stunning and functional smile.

Recovery and Aftercare Tips



Recuperation from a full-arch substitute procedure is crucial for guaranteeing the success of your implants and overall dental wellness. After your surgical procedure, you'll likely experience some swelling and pain, which is totally regular. To handle this, take prescribed pain medications as guided and use ice packs to lower swelling.

Follow a soft food diet regimen for the initial few days. Foods like yogurt, smoothie mixes, and mashed potatoes are excellent choices. Prevent hard, crunchy, or sticky foods that might disrupt the recovery procedure. Staying moisturized is essential, so drink a lot of water.

Attend follow-up visits with your dental professional to monitor your recovery progression. If you observe any unusual pain, swelling, or signs of infection, contact your dentist immediately.
